There are two basic styles sherry; Fino and the similar Manzanilla - pale, delicate, and bone dry; Amontillado and Oloroso - dark, nutty and complex. And we … WebbDifferent type of sherry has different serving temperature: Fino or Manzanillo: 7-9ºC or 44-48ºF. Pale Cream: 9ºC or 48ºF. Medium or Cream: 10-12ºC or 50-54ºF. Dry Amontillado or Oloroso: 12-14ºC or 53-57ºF. …
